Has an NCAA Women's Basketball game ever ended 85-30?
It has. 85-30 has been a NCAA Women's Basketball final 3 times in 129,040 games. The first was Texas Southern Tigers beat Mississippi Valley State Devilettes on February 20, 2016; the latest was Quinnipiac Bobcats beat Hartford Hawks on November 14, 2022.
That makes 85-30 the 2448th most common final score out of 3,854 that have ever occurred in NCAA Women's Basketball. One point away, 86-30 has happened 6 times and 85-31 has happened 4 times. Nearly all of its occurrences fall between 2010 and 2039.
